The role you’ll contribute:
Installs, operates, and maintains the organization's heating and air conditioning (HVAC) systems.
The value you’ll bring to the team:
- Installs, inspects, maintains, repairs, and performs preventive maintenance on all heating, air conditioning and ventilation systems.
- Maintains and applies current knowledge of steam distribution piping, valves, chilled and hot water reheat systems, and Pressure Reducing Value (PRV) operation.
- Develops and implements departmental equipment procedures for power outages.
- Prepares the preventive maintenance schedule and produces monthly reports.
- Identifies equipment needs, parts and supplies, and maintains adequate inventory.
- Knows and adheres to safety codes and regulatory agency requirements.
E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:
High school diploma/GED with 2 years of experience, or Associate's degree, or Technical degree required.
LICENSURE, CERTIFICATION OR REGISTRATION PREFFERRED:
- Certification specializing in Heating, Piping & Cooling.
